DeviceNet Communications Specifications
Note
(1) The IN Area can be divided into two blocks only when a CS/CJ-series De-
viceNet Unit is used as the master. (The connection type can also be se-
lected.) If a CVM1, CV, or C200HX/HG/HE DeviceNet Master Unit is used
as the master, the IN Area must be in 1 block with a maximum 100 words
(200 bytes). (Polling connection only.)
(2) If a CVM1, CV, or C200HX/HG/HE DeviceNet Master Unit used, only up
to 32 words can be allocated per node.
1-2-2
DeviceNet General Specifications
Item
Specifications
Communications protocol
Conforms to DeviceNet
Communica-
tions functions
Remote I/O
communications
• Master-slave connections (polling, bit-strobe, COS, or cyclic)
• Conform to DeviceNet specifications.
I/O allocations
• Can allocate any I/O data from the Configurator.
• Can allocate any data, such parameters specific to the DeviceNet and the Digital
Controller variable area.
• Up to 2 blocks for the IN Area, up to a total of 100 words (See note 1.)
• One block for the OUT Area, up to 100 words (The first word is always allocated to
Output Enable Bits.) (See note 2.)
Message com-
munications
• Explicit message communications
• CompoWay/F communications commands can be sent (commands are sent in
explicit message format).
Connection format
Combination of multidrop and T-branch connections (for trunk and drop lines)
Baud rate
DeviceNet: 500, 250, or 125 kbps, or automatic detection of master baud rate
Communications media
Special 5-wire cable (2 signal lines, 2 power lines, and 1 shield line)
Communications distance
Baud rate
Network length
Drop line length
Total drop line length
500 kbps
100 m max. (100 m max.) 6 m max.
39 m max.
250 kbps
100 m max. (250 m max.) 6 m max.
78 m max.
125 kbps
100 m max. (500 m max.) 6 m max.
156 m max.
The values in parentheses apply when Thick Cables are used.
